# Break-Glass: Catalog Cache Invalidation

Scope: the Pinrow product catalog at Veldstone Retail. If stale prices persist after a purge and the Hollowmere invalidation queue is wedged, use break-glass to flush the edge tier directly. Contractors: get verbal sign-off from the catalog lead first. Steps: open the Hollowmere admin shell, select emergency-flush, confirm the tenant, and run it once — repeated flushes thrash the origin. Access is logged and expires after 20 minutes. Unseal the admin shell with the passphrase below.

recovery phrase for kahop-tajog: istix-casvan

Deep-link routing on Lanternleaf Mobile is trending up ~12% week over week, mostly from the Fernway campaign. Current resolver pods hold steady at peak, but cache eviction is getting aggressive. We propose bumping pool sizes and TTLs before the holiday push. For the sync, here are the current tuning constants we plan to adjust.

tuning table, kajog-bawip:
TIERS = {
    "kelius": 256,
    "lammir": 543,
}

Action item (P1): Complete the leaked-file-descriptor hunt in the Marrowgate proxy tier. Root cause traced to TLS session handles not released on handshake timeout. Owner: platform team; due end of sprint. Security review requested because exhausted descriptors caused silent drops of audit-log writes for ~40 minutes during the incident. Verify no audit gaps remain and confirm the fix covers the mutual-TLS path. Evidence and descriptor traces are collected on the internal page.

operations page: https://jira.qorvelsys.internal/browse/pages/browse/pages

## Deploying the Gatewick Proctor Queue

Deploys are pretty painless: push to main, wait for the pipeline, then watch the queue drain dashboard for five minutes. If candidates pile up mid-exam, roll back first and ask questions later — the queue replays safely. Everything the workers care about lives in one config block, shown here for reference.

settings of bafof-yagef:
JOROX_PIN=8740
JOROX_TENANT=pelox
JOROX_METRICS_HOST=metrics.jorox.qorvelworks.internal
JOROX_SEAL=seal_c78f63c1
JOROX_STANDBY_TEAM=norax